Holding the two side by side the Mark-2 reflects light blue with direct natural light where the V6 has a heavier darker purple. Both crystals disappear but the Mark-2 is higher quality. Mikey's crystal is better but the V6 crystal and AR is good. I think a quality V6 is good out the box.
